Types of Under Bed Cat Blockers I Considered
I found that there are a few common types of blockers, and each one works differently:
- Fabric bed blockers: These attach around the bed frame and block the opening with cloth or mesh.
- Plastic or acrylic panels: These create a more rigid barrier and are good if I want a firmer solution.
- Foam blockers: These are lightweight and easy to fit into gaps, but they may not be ideal for strong or determined cats.
- DIY blockers: I also saw people using storage bins, cardboard, or pool noodles, though these are usually temporary fixes.
What I Looked for Before Buying
When I compared products, I focused on a few important features:
1. Proper fit
I measured the height and clearance under my bed before buying anything. A blocker only works well if it covers the gap completely.
2. Durability
My cat can be persistent, so I wanted something that would not tear, bend, or slide out of place easily.
3. Easy installation
I preferred a blocker that I could install without special tools. If it was too complicated, I knew I would probably avoid using it.
4. Safety
I made sure the material would not have sharp edges, loose parts, or anything my cat could chew on.
5. Appearance
Since the bed is in my bedroom, I wanted a blocker that looked neat and blended in with my furniture.
